The research cooperation for livestock based sustainable farming systems in the Lower Mekong Basin

For the past four years, Cambodia, Laos, Thailand and Vietnam have cooperated within animal production research in a regional network, the Research Cooperation for Livestock Based Sustainable Farming Systems in the Lower Mekong Basin (MEKARN). This document presents an evaluation of the effectiveness of (MEKARN).The evaluation finds that effectiveness of the programme in terms of capacity building is high. The research objectives, concerning sustainable technology development, regional cooperation in research, training materials and database production, and information sharing, have been almost fully met. MEKARN has therefore met its development objectives. <br /><br />Recommendations include: support for a third phase of MEKARN cooperation as a regional activity, focusing on livestock based sustainable farming systems should be considered the MSc-training should continue and be expanded, particularly as regards participation from Cambodia and Laos the gender perspective should remain in focus the MSc-training should maintain its high level, and give the students a good insight into integrated production systems with the focus on livestock based production systems, and give them a solid training in animal nutrition and production. <br />
